    Chapter One (haven't decided what to call the story yet)
    (spoilered for being a wall of text)

    Spoiler
    Show
    My life truly began the day I got my cutie mark. I guess that’s normal, but to be honest, I can hardly remember what happened before then. I was an average colt, intelligent but shy, with no real friends and too many books. It comes with being a unicorn, I guess—even the famed Twilight Sparkle spent more of her childhood in the company of books than that of friends.

    It was worse for me, though. I had been cursed (in hindsight, blessed, but hindsight is funny like that) with a perfectly average appearance, along with the ability to just blend in with my surroundings. White coat, black mane, grey eyes, and a skinny build for a colt which I’ve kept well into stallionhood. An uninteresting name, Shadow (for my black mane, which my mother always loved). Perfectly normal, perfectly average, perfectly unremarkable. And, being so truly unremarkable, I was never accepted into Celestia’s famed unicorn academy. I vaguely remember being upset when I received the rejection letter from Ponyville’s mailpony, Dorky Doo (mother of our current mailpony Ditzy Doo). I may have even cried. It seems almost funny, looking back.

    Not long after that, upset at my lack of special talent, or anything to set me apart for that matter, I ran away from home. And where else was a lonely, untalented, unwanted young buck to go but the Everfree Forest? I think I truly intended to die there. And I very nearly got that wish. As I pressed deeper and the vines and leaves pressed in around me, I heard more and more deep, animalistic noises. Eventually, cold and wet from a sudden squall of rain, I emerged from the brush in front of an enormous cave. I had already accepted my fate; anything this horrible place threw at me, I would simply let it happen. So I walked right in.

    It quickly grew too dark to see, and the deep growls and snarls were growing louder all the time. I pressed on, determining to see this final adventure through to the end, and before long I bumped into a huge wall of furry flesh. The cavern lit up with a pale glow like starlight, and the vast creature reared up with a sleepy growl. An Ursa. Not a bad way to go, I guess. Except Fate had other things in store for me. I cowered as the creature drew up a humongous paw to end my short, meaningless existence… And in that moment, everything changed. I didn’t want to die. I didn’t think my life was meaningless. And who did this creature think it was, to try to kill ME? HOW DARE IT? Power, unlike any I had experienced in my previous studies, surged through my body and left my horn in a pure, black beam.

    I must have blacked out. When I woke up, there was blood in my mouth and nose. I shook it off, but the foul metallic taste clung to my tongue and settled in the back of my throat. The cavern was lit with the barest edge of daylight, enough to see the fuzzy outline of the Ursa as it lay in the center of the cave, unmoving. I crept towards it slowly, not knowing if it was asleep or awake. As I passed the huge, fallen head, I saw that the eyes were still open and froze… But they were glazed and grey, unmoving… dead. I had cast my first real spell: a Death spell. And with just my own power, I had slain an Ursa.

    I staggered from the beshadowed cave into the light of what was, to me at least, my first day. A convenient pool of water drew my attention; I really needed to wash up, to get the blood from my face before heading home. As I finished scrubbing my face with my hooves, something caught my eye: where before had been a blank white flank was now a cutie mark, one that would define my whole life: the Grim Pony’s scythe.
